Is Centrum Advantage GERD Friendly?
Why it's not GERD friendly
- citric acid
citric acid
Dietitian noteCitric acid, a common food additive, is a known GERD trigger due to its high acidity, which can directly irritate the esophagus. It can also weaken the lower esophageal sphincter, allowing stomach acid to flow back up and cause heartburn. Furthermore, even small amounts of citric acid can significantly increase stomach acid production, worsening reflux symptoms.
